About This Course

The adoption of renewable energy sources like wind and solar power for generating electricity is increasingly prevalent in our society as we transition away from fossil fuels towards more environmentally friendly forms of energy that do not produce carbon dioxide. The urgency of this transition cannot be overstated, and we must actively promote alternative methods of meeting our energy needs. This course offers a comprehensive overview of wind energy, examining it from both academic and industrial perspectives.
